Chuck Ellis welcomes Adrienne Paul, Republican candidate for Maine House District 85 (most of Standish and parts of Steep Falls). A single mom-raised entrepreneur who built a childcare center for 80 children, Adrienne explains why she’s running: to tackle Maine’s crushing costs in childcare, healthcare, housing, and energy. From infant care ratios and state waste to overregulation and rising heating bills, this conversation dives deep into the real struggles Maine families face — and practical solutions that actually make sense.A must-listen for anyone in Cumberland County or concerned about affordability in Maine.Learn more about Adrienne: adrienpaul.com
